Given that,
The angle between the piling and the pier is 60°.
A surveyor has set up his transit on one side of the lake 130 feet from a piling that is directly across from a pier on the other side of the lake.
We need to find the distance between the piling and the pier. Let the distance be d. Using the trigonometry to find it as follows :
![\tan(60)=\dfrac{x}{130}\\\\x=\tan(60)\times 130\\\\x=225.16\ feet](https://tex.z-dn.net/?f=%5Ctan%2860%29%3D%5Cdfrac%7Bx%7D%7B130%7D%5C%5C%5C%5Cx%3D%5Ctan%2860%29%5Ctimes%20130%5C%5C%5C%5Cx%3D225.16%5C%20feet)
So, the required distance is 225.16 feet.

The correct answer is 25%
<h3>
What is Relative Frequency?</h3>
- The number of times an event occurs divided by the total number of events occurring in a given data.
<h3>How to solve the problem?</h3>
- This problem can be solved by following steps.
- The data of color and frequency is given in table.
- We need find the relative frequency for Purple
First calculate the the total number of frequency
18+20+10+16
= 64
The total number of frequency is 64
Hence the relative frequency of purple is 16/64
Therefore , relative frequency of purple is 1/4 = 0.25
Therefore 25% of purple candies are there
